According to Indian religious and philosophical practices, people must fulfill a moral duty which is called

Social Studies
2 answers:
wariber [46]3 years ago
8 0
By definition, karma means deed or action in the Sanskrit language. At times, the word is not only exclusive to the deed itself but also used in referring to the power of the deed to bring about consequences.

________ is the tendency to rely too heavily on one trait or piece of information when making decisions. Group of answer choices
tangare [24]

Answer:

Anchoring

Explanation:

The anchor may be explained as the first piece of information which an individual has access to. This anchor, or information, hence affects the decision made by the individual as they rely so heavily on it no matter the level or degree of veracity of the information. The anchor may be seen as a particular reference point over which a the person uses as a benchmark for his belief on certain issues. For instance, a person might had an initial information on a particular subject. This information might be adopted by the person as an anchor such that he relies so heavily on it no matter how false it may seem.
